Avoiding a fight is a mark of honor; only fools insist on quarreling. (Proverbs 20:3 NLT) There might just be a few more fools in this world than there are wise at the moment. It seems everyone wants to quarrel about anything they don't like or agree with, doesn't it? The wise will do anything short of sin to avoid he quarrel, though. Why? It brings out things that never should be voiced, and it creates a set of circumstances that allow a 'build up' of things that should never be done. The fool speaks his mind without thought as to how the message will be received. He isn't concerned about the ones hearing it - he just insists on voicing it. The wise think first about who will hear their message and how it will affect those who do hear it. Perhaps the question we need to be asking is how we can avoid a quarrel when all around us there seem to be quarrelers.
